From Parked Play to Passenger Screen Gaming: A New Chapter Begins

For years, screens in cars have been about driving, navigation, parking sensors, or climate control.

But the passenger screen? That’s something different. It’s about creating a space for entertainment, one that’s personal, intuitive, and now… interactive.

Through our latest partnership with Audi, AirConsole is now live on the passenger display, bringing games to life while the car is in motion. While that might seem like a small shift on the surface, it marks a big leap forward for passenger screen gaming and how people experience entertainment on the road.

Until now, in-car gaming was mostly a stationary experience. You parked and shared your screen to play together, which is a lot of fun and a big part of what we offer. But when we looked at how people actually move, travel, and spend time in the car, we saw something missing: a way for passengers to play games during a drive, without interrupting the driving experience.

The front-passenger display was the key to unlocking that.

Passenger Screen Gaming: Built for Motion

Gaming in Audi cars doesn’t just shift the display. It shifts the paradigm:

  • Passengers can now enjoy games independently while the vehicle is moving.

  • Drivers stay fully focused, no shared screen, no input required.

  • Your smartphone becomes the controller, keeping the experience lightweight and instantly accessible.

This evolution isn’t just technical, it’s experiential. It aligns with a broader trend across the industry: turning the cabin into a connected car experience. With more OEMs introducing multi-screen car interiors, AirConsole is helping define what interactive entertainment in the car can look like. And for Audi drivers, that future is already here.

To make this work, we had to rethink how games launch, display, and respond to motion, all while ensuring full separation from driver functionality. It’s a fine balance of UX design, safety, and technical integration.


What This Means for the Future

As more carmakers integrate passenger screens, we believe that passenger screen gaming will become a standard expectation: If you can watch a movie or check your messages as a passenger, why not play a game in the car?

Passenger screen isn’t a novelty, it’s fast becoming an expected part of premium digital cockpits. BMW, Mercedes, and now Audi are leading the charge. At AirConsole, we’re proud to help bring Audi’s passenger screen gaming experience to life in a way that’s playful, safe, and frictionless.

The best part? You don’t need to download anything or carry extra hardware. With AirConsole’s Audi app, the experience lives in the car and in your pocket—just scan the screen, and your phone becomes the controller.

This is just one step on a larger journey to make in-car gaming a natural part of mobility, and we’re just getting started.
